After a bomb blast in Mumbai, four individuals, including a reporter, an executive, a computer tech, and a police officer, face personal challenges and eventually find healing and resolution. Mumbai Meri Jaan is a 2008 Indian Hindi-language Drama motion picture starring R. Madhavan, Irfan Khan, Soha Ali Khan, Kay Kay Menon, Paresh Rawal, Irrfan Khan and Akkash Basnet. Mumbai Meri Jaan was Produced by Ronnie Screwvala. Mumbai Meri Jaan is written by Yogesh Vinayak Joshi and Upendra Sidhaye and it is directed by Nishikant Kamat and Nishikanth Kamath. UTV Motion Pictures acquired the distribution rights for the motion picture. Mumbai Meri Jaan was released on 22nd August 2008 and takes a screen time of 135 minutes. Mumbai Meri Jaan was made on a budget of ₹3 crore and it was a hit at box office gross of ₹3 crore. Cinematography was done by Sanjay Jadhav and editing by Amit Pawar. The music was composed by Sameer Phaterpekar. At the 2009 Filmfare Awards It won 2 awards including: Best Screenplay and Best Editing.
